About USAMEB goarmy.com

    https://www.goarmy.com/meb/about-meb.html
    Sep 11, 2019 · The move marked the brigade’s official departure from the legacy name U.S. Army Accessions Support Brigade (USAASB) and its previous alignment under Army Accessions Command, which was deactivated in 2012. Today, the brigade is a direct reporting unit to the Assistant Secretary of the Army for Manpower and Reserve Affairs.
